Anemometer Fundamentals





A necessary tool utilized to measure wind rate and direction, the anemometer plays an essential role in weather forecasting and different industries. An anemometer generally is composed of three or 4 cups that rotate in the wind, a vane that points into the wind, and sensing units to track the turnings or motions. By calculating the turnings or motions over a particular period, the anemometer can establish wind speed. The vane helps figure out wind direction by aiming into the wind, providing beneficial data for weather projecting, aviation, maritime procedures, environmental surveillance, and wind energy applications.


There are various sorts of anemometers readily available, including mug anemometers, vane anemometers, hot-wire anemometers, and sonic anemometers, each with its unique attributes and applications. Cup anemometers are frequently used for fundamental wind rate measurements, while vane anemometers are liked for directional measurements. Hot-wire anemometers appropriate for reduced airspeeds, and sonic anemometers are perfect for high-precision dimensions in research study and commercial setups. Comprehending the basics of anemometers is vital for accurate wind data collection and evaluation throughout different sectors.


Principles of Anemometer Operation





Structure on the foundational understanding of anemometer basics, the concepts of anemometer procedure elucidate the technicians behind wind rate and direction dimensions. Mug anemometers, for instance, have 3 or more mugs that catch the wind, creating them to rotate faster as the wind rate boosts. Hot-wire anemometers rely on a heated cable that cools down as wind passes over it, with the rate of cooling down identifying the wind rate.

Applications Throughout Numerous Industries



In the sustainable power market, anemometers play a crucial role in evaluating wind conditions for wind farm placements, making certain optimum power production. Industries like construction and mining utilize anemometers to keep track of wind speeds, essential for security protocols, especially when working at heights or in open-pit mines where strong winds can pose hazards. In farming, anemometers aid farmers in handling crop spraying by giving real-time information on wind speed to avoid drift.
